統測
113年
[電機與電子群資電類] 專業科目(2)
第 13 題
直接記憶體存取(DMA)是常用於大量資料傳輸的技術,下列敘述何者正確?
- A 可以減少資料搬移佔用CPU時間
- B 無法直接用於外部儲存裝置間的資料傳輸
- C DMA只需要使用來源及目的記憶體的起始位址,即可進行資料搬移
- D IC 8255是常用的DMA控制器
思路引導 VIP
請從系統效能優化的角度思考:在傳統的程式控制 $I/O$ 模式中,若每一筆資料的搬移都需要 $CPU$ 親自下達指令並透過暫存器中轉,對於 $CPU$ 的運算資源會造成什麼樣的負擔?而 $DMA$ 控制器接管了這項「搬運工作」後,最直接的效益是讓 $CPU$ 能從哪種重複性的任務中抽身,轉而處理更複雜的運算?
🤖
AI 詳解
AI 專屬家教
🌟 太棒了!你真的很用心,觀念學得非常紮實!
這次的題目你掌握得非常好,精準理解了 直接記憶體存取 (DMA) 這個重要的概念。來,我們一起再深入複習一下:
- 為什麼 (A) 是正確的呢?
▼ 還有更多解析內容